The passive band pass filter can be used to isolate or filter out certain frequencies that lie within a particular band or range of frequencies. Band pass filter passes a band of frequencies between a lower cutoff frequency, f l, and an upper cutoff frequency, f h. Bandpass filters are widely used in wireless transmitters and receivers.
